5. Data sharing
We do not sell personal data. We may share data only when necessary
to operate the service, for example with hosting providers, technical
analytics, support providers, payment processors, app stores, security
tools, advertising providers, or public authorities when required by
law. Business card data recognition is performed on the device. On
iOS, recognition uses Vision and VisionKit, APIs provided by Apple.
On Android, it uses Google ML Kit Text Recognition, provided by Google.
In both cases, there is no sending of card data to external OCR APIs.
We require service providers to process data according to instructions
compatible with this Policy and to adopt reasonable protection measures.
